# Who to Contact: Retrying Failed Exports

Failed exports from the Quillport reporting pipeline can be retried from the Batchlight console under Jobs → Failed. Retry at most twice; repeated failures usually indicate a schema drift issue upstream, not a transient error. If an export is blocking a release sign-off, do not keep retrying — escalate instead. The Datamill team owns the pipeline and triages export failures within one business day. For release-blocking cases, reach them at the address below.

escalation mailbox, bafog-fafog: ulador@paliqlabs.internal

# Configuration hot-reload notes for the Brindlewick gateway.
# The watcher process re-reads this file every thirty seconds and applies
# non-secret keys in place; no restart needed for timeouts, log levels,
# or feature flags. Secret-bearing keys are the exception: they are read
# once at boot and cached in memory, so editing them here does nothing
# until the service restarts. Keep that distinction in mind when rotating
# credentials. The upstream broker credential is defined on the next line.

env line for fafof-fahag: LEDGER_TOKEN5=f8790

This cycle validates the bot's new grace-period logic before it deletes branches idle for more than ninety days. Scope includes dry-run reporting, owner notification batching, and the protected-branch exclusion list. All test runs execute against the Brambleshear staging forge, never the production mirror, since deletions are irreversible there. The bot authenticates to the forge API with a bearer token scoped to `repo:prune` on staging only; confirm it has not expired before kicking off the suite. The staging token for this cycle is:

session JWT of yawep-yawep = eyJhbGciOiJIUzI1NiIsInR5cCI6IkpXVCJ9.eyJzdWIiOiI3pWF3_In0.aXYsHiog

Subject: Quickstore 4.2 — bloom filter now fronts the KV layer

Plugin authors: starting with this release, Quickstore places a bloom filter ahead of the key-value store. Negative lookups return faster; false positives fall through safely. No API changes are required on your side. Verify your plugin against the staging build referenced below.

session token of fahif-tadup = htk3_9c7